Substance Abuse Treatment Services

Substance abuse treatment services are available in a number of settings with different treatment lengths and plans to accommodate the various needs of clients with any kind of and amount of addiction. With both long and short term and both inpatient and residential centers now being included in many insurance plans, you don't have to postpone receiving substance abuse treatment services for anyone who wants it.

Outpatient

Outpatient services are on the bottom end of the spectrum of treatment services in terms of intensity of care, because the individual can preserve their lifestyle in many ways without the commitment of needing to remain in a rehabilitation facility while receiving rehab services. Although this might seem perfect it might not provide the required change of atmosphere than many individuals in rehab need to experience a productive rehabilitation.

Persons With Co-Occurring Mental And Substance Abuse Disorders

Persons with co-occurring mental and drug use disorders are what are recognized in the field of drug and alcohol treatment as dual diagnosis clients. These individuals must address both disorders whilst in rehab to find resolution because one usually exacerbates the other. Luckily, there are several drug and alcohol rehab centers who are able to specifically address the problems that persons with co-occurring mental and substance abuse disorders face to be able to not merely become abstinent but mentally stable and also able to lead a much better quality lifestyle and not wish to self medicate with drugs and alcohol.

DUI/DWI Offenders

DUI and DWI offenders in many cases are given the option or ordered to rehabilitation as part of sentencing. Quite often, the offender can choose which treatment facility they would like to attend. Upon successful completion, DUI and DWI offenders benefit from decreased sentencing options to enable them to move ahead in their lives without getting penalized further.

Criminal Justice Clients

Criminal justice clients get into treatment as part of a court order in order to meet part of their sentencing for any drug offense. Criminal justice clients in drug treatment frequently receive reduced penalties, fines etc. when cooperating with drug treatment requirements enforced on them in sentencing specifically of course when successfully completing a drug rehabilitation facility.

Self Payment

Self Payment is required when someone's insurance won't pay for the entire cost of rehabilitation or will only cover part of it. In these situations, it may seem like a drawback but individuals really have a great deal of leverage because they can choose whichever center they want without the restrictions from health insurance providers that so many men and women encounter. Likewise, rehabilitation centers will frequently provide payment assistance for individuals whose only choice is self payment to enable them to get into rehabilitation.

Medicaid

Some treatment centers will take Medicaid in the event the individual is not able to self pay or present any other kind of private health insurance. Medicaid might cover outpatient and short-term rehabilitation within a limited amount of facilities, and in such cases individuals might want to explore the self pay alternative and drum up any resources they can to cover a more quality treatment facility which will get better results, say for example a long-term residential drug and alcohol rehab facility.

Private Health Insurance

Depending on which program you are covered by, all private health care insurance plans typically cover some form of alcohol and drug treatment service including outpatient treatment to inpatient or residential drug and alcohol treatment programs. Individuals might have to take part in a drug treatment program that is in their network of providers and there could be other restrictions such as the length of time their stay in rehab is covered. Individuals can choose a quality center they prefer and speak with a rehab counselor to find out if their insurance will take care of it.

Sliding Fee Scale

A sliding fee scale is a payment assistance possibility made available from a number of drug and alcohol rehab centers in order to help individuals afford rehab where this might not have been doable initially. By way of example, one client's price for treatment could be different and someone else whose financial situation is better which makes them more prepared to pay for the full cost of rehabilitation. Registrars consider additional factors aside from income including number of dependents to ascertain the ultimate cost and using the sliding scale.
